Quick Oral Answer
The gas evolved is carbon dioxide (). It can be tested by passing it through lime water, which turns milky.
Analysis & Explanation
When ethanoic acid (acetic acid, ) reacts with sodium bicarbonate (), a neutralization reaction occurs that releases carbon dioxide gas (). The reaction is: . The rapid evolution of causes 'brisk effervescence'. Carbon dioxide is a colourless and odourless gas, making Option A correct. Option B is wrong because is not pungent. Option C is wrong because a reaction definitely occurs. Option D is wrong because does not support combustion; it would actually extinguish a glowing splinter.
